Ruby Waage Townsend
Ruby Waage Townsend (b.1996, Leicester, UK) is an interdisciplinary artist working across painting, performance, installation, and myth. Their practice treats painting as a performative act, creating immersive worlds where folklore, dark humour, enchanted realism, and unstable identities collide through theatrical self-portraiture and world-building.
Ruby is currently completing an MFA in Painting at The Slade School of Fine Art and graduated with a BA (Hons) Fine Art
from De Montfort University in 2023. Recent highlights include a commissioned portrait of Baroness Doreen Lawrence, residencies with AA2A and UK New Artists, and receiving the Irving Wernick Scholarship and Elizabeth Greenshields Foundation Grant.
